Citi analyst James Hardiman downgraded BRP Inc. (NASDAQ: DOOO) from Neutral to Sell with a price target of $29.00 (from $48.00).
The analyst comments "We are downgrading shares of both PII and DOO from Neutral to Sell, as both are dealing with a deteriorating and increasingly promotional end market, meaningful headwinds from incremental Chinese tariffs, and a potentially untenable situation with respect to Mexico and Canada tariffs. Were 25% tariffs on Mexican and Canadian imports to be levied indefinitely (an unlikely but distinct possibility), we believe that both companies would immediately incur significant losses, impacting their long-term prospects . Even in the absence of this scenario, however, the weakening of fundamentals in conjunction with the incremental Chinese tariffs is enough to weigh on valuations going forward."

Shares of BRP Inc. closed at $38.73 yesterday.
